Fort Worth, Texas - C.B. Baird, Jr. (Cy), 92, died June 28 in Fort Worth, Texas and entered his eternal and heavenly home.

Cy was born May 11, 1929 in Fort Worth, Texas. The son of C.B., Sr. and Flora Adele Baird. He graduated from Paschal High School in 1946 where he lettered in multiple sports. Cy graduated from Rice University with a BA in 1950.

Following graduation, Cy returned to Fort Worth and married Myrna Joy Craig and had four children. Cy began his career teaching in the Fort Worth ISD. After receiving his Masters of Education from TCU, Cy became the Principal at the first air-conditioned school in Fort Worth, J.P. Moore.

Cy loved summer trips to Gunnison, Colorado. He loved the outdoors and particularly fly fishing the many rivers and streams in the area. He also enjoyed winter and spring trips to South Padre Island.

Cy served on various boards in the Fort Worth community including: the management committee for the Central YMCA of Fort Worth, Director on the Community Council of Fort Worth, and Director on the Mrs. Baird's Bakery Board of Directors.

Cy was very philanthropic through his own foundation and in being the founding donor of the Ninnie L. Baird Foundation. He also had an affinity for the arts and was an avid supporter of the Gunnison Arts Center.

Cy was most proud of his children and grandchildren and all their accomplishments. He loved attending their sporting events and taking them to get ice cream.

Survivors: Cy is survived by his brother, Byron Baird, his wife, Marilyn, and their sons Ross and Steven; daughter, Becky Barber, son, Craig Baird and wife Carrie, son, Bruce Baird and wife Laura, daughter, Cindy Beall and husband, John; grandchildren Flora Baird, Hunter Baird and wife Lindsey, Margaret Lynn and husband Doug, Parker Beall, Keagan Beall and wife Kellie, Haylee Train, Tara Barber, Cooper Baird and Colton Baird; great grandchild Adele Baird.

The family will hold a private ceremony to honor Cy.
